#e8fe56 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#e8fe56 is composed of 91% red, 99.6% green and 33.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 8.7% cyan, 0% magenta, 66.1% yellow and 0.4% black. It has a hue angle of 67.9 degrees, a saturation of 98.8% and a lightness of 66.7%. #e8fe56 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ffac with #d1fd00. Closest websafe color is: #ffff66.

#e8fe56 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#e8fe56 has RGB values of R:232, G:254, B:86 and CMYK values of C:0.09, M:0, Y:0.66, K:0. Its decimal value is 15269462.

Shades and Tints of #e8fe56
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#060600 is the darkest color, while #fdfff2 is the lightest one.
